Electric cars are here to stay, crossing the 1000km autonomy mark… too hot to handle?

Electric VEHICLES THE NEXT STEPS

The Automotive industry is taking solid steps to be a green alternative to cut emissions

This week I read incredible news. Mercedes new EQXX has crossed the 1000km autonomy in a single charge. This type of autonomy is a game changer to equalize more and more the EV (electric vehicles) technology with petrol engines. Of course, this is still not widely adopted but gives a hint that Electrical cars are here to stay. Also, quite impressing Carlo´s Sainz Audi´s RSQ e-tron electric car wining Dakar offroad stages.

The influence of Formula One and Dakar competitions are showing that EV and climate friendly technologies can be cool too. Some of the breakthrough technological evolutions coming to commercial cars in improving weight, efficiency and cost are coming from the top automotive competitions. One of the key trends is to increase the density of the battery to allow to lightweight and probably reduce the production costs. Also, other areas of EV cars are being improve thanks to incentives to compete at a top level, like power trains, solar roof panels and the inverter.

A long way from the boring first electric models that initially came to the market (not to mention names and ugly models 😊).

In a similar trend, also read this week that SONY has created a vehicle company to pilot their exposure to electric vehicles. The fact that nontraditional manufacturers are entering the market is just exciting. This implies automotive and technology are merging more and more into a new evolved market where OEMs might not be the only winners.

Maybe the sound quality of SONY cars will take us the next level recovering the old-time supreme quality?… will see.

In my opinion, the EVs are good news but we need other technologies to compete and create alternatives that allows an efficient development of the market. Infrastructure will also play an important role and there will be a phase-out transition on the electricity production from fossil fuels that will not assure emissions are fully cut in the production side. Hydrogen and biofuels (for shipping and aviation for example) should also have a say in the transportation market.

Cost and pricing of these technologies are the pending matter… EVs or other green transport technologies should not be accessible only to the rich countries. Currently, only 1% of total cars sales are EVs outside (EU, US and China). So, a lot to do in this front.

In any case, the trend seems unstoppable and is great news for the Planet…
